This assessment of radiographic image enhancement methods is part of an effort to determine the usefulness of radiographic inspection and the enhancement of radiographic images for monitoring or inspecting refractory-lined components of coal conversion systems. Enhancement offers the potential to bring out details that cannot be readily detected in original radiographs and to sharpen edges of bore contours so that one can more easily measure wall thicknesses and detect details such as cracks, voids, or inclusions. This report includes a review of image enhancement methods and the results of a quantitative test to evaluate image enhancement procedures for radiographs typical of a field environment. Direct measurements of a refractory cylinder wall thickness are compared with measurements made from radiographs and enhancements.
